그래서 저는 이와 같은 Bash 스크립트를 가지고 있습니다. 목표는 실행 파일의 경로를 결정하고 그것을 인쇄하고 싶습니다. 이것이 제가 하고 있는 일입니다.
#!/bin/bash
exepath=which exe
echo "$exepath"
이제 경로를 인쇄하는 대신 내 시스템에서 exe 파일을 실행하는 대신 exepath 변수에 저장된 경로를 어떻게 인쇄할 수 있습니까?
답변1
바꾸다
exepath=which exe
(이 명령은 방금 실행되었으며 exe
환경 변수는 이전에 exepath
리터럴 값으로 설정되었습니다 which
.)
당신은 사용해야합니다
exepath=`which exe`
또는
exepath=$(which exe)